My budget would be a balanced one: Former standing committee chairman Sandip Joshi

I would have gone for a people-friendly budget, avoiding big announcements without having any base. Being responsible for getting works done, I would have stressed more on recovery and avoided taxing the citizens.
Property Tax
There is much scope to increase revenue from property tax. I would have announced a time bound programme to bring all properties in the city under tax purview.
Over 50,000 properties are not under tax ambit. Same is the case with revaluation of existing properties. I would have declared regular camps and a single window system for providing easy access to the citizens.
Advertisement policy
Advertisement policy would have been one of my budget highlights. I would have ensured at least 10 new revenue sources from advertisements. For example, around 5,000 autos and 470 Starbuses ply in the city. I would have ensured these vehicles attract advertisements and the auto drivers, bus staffers are provided proper facilities.
Town planning
Town planning department is also a major revenue source but neglected. I would have announced online facilities for transparency and speedy processing. I would have brought new policies to encourage parking in residential and commercial buildings to put an end to several issues at a time.

Civic facilities
Proper vegetable markets in the city are need of the hour. I would have gone for construction of simple market places instead of proposing big projects. Similarly, I would make the system flexible so that citizens can approach the Nagpur Municipal Corporation easily. No big plans are needed for providing birth/ death certificates, marriage registration. I would have opened ward-wise offices or started online facilities to ensure proper services.
Health care
I would have come up with good medical schemes. Many NGOs, organizations and corporate houses are ready to lend a helping hand to the NMC in providing cheap medical facilities to citizens.
Citizens' feedback
My budget would have been a balanced one with focus on expenditure and implementation to benefit the common man. In order to get regular feedback from citizens, I would have made all possible efforts to meet them through various initiatives like Lokshahi Din etc.
(Former standing committee chairman Sandip Joshi dons the hat of the municipal commissioner and suggests his budget)
